Overnight Schedule: 10:00 PM–6:30 AM
The Overnight Kitchen Production Lead is a newly introduced, hands-on leadership position responsible for coordinating kitchen production during overnight hours. Working closely with the Kitchen Manager and Grab & Go Team, this individual will guide overnight team members, organize daily production priorities, and ensure all food is properly prepared, packaged, labeled, and stocked for the following day.
The ideal candidate is a dependable and experienced kitchen professional who can lead by example, maintain high standards, and keep production moving efficiently in a fast-paced environment. This position plays an essential role in preparing the department for a smooth and successful morning shift.
